feat(01-05): wire main.py lifespan+health and rewrite documents+topics to async session

- Rewrite main.py lifespan: MinIO client created at startup, docuvault bucket
  auto-created if missing, stored on app.state.minio; engine.dispose() on shutdown
- Extend /health endpoint: probes PostgreSQL (SELECT 1) and MinIO (bucket_exists)
  returning {"status": "ok"|"degraded", "checks": {"postgres": ..., "minio": ...}}
- Rewrite api/documents.py: all routes inject session: AsyncSession = Depends(get_db);
  save_upload/save_metadata/list_metadata/get_metadata/delete_document all async;
  upload handler queues extract_and_classify.delay() instead of inline classification;
  /classify endpoint retains synchronous await classifier.classify_document() for
  backward-compatible immediate response
- Rewrite api/topics.py: all routes inject session dependency; all storage calls
  are async with session parameter; Pydantic models TopicCreate/TopicUpdate/
  SuggestRequest preserved verbatim
